# CHAPTER 1 - Market Overview

The Singapore E-Commerce Logistics Market operates through platform-integrated parcel networks, fulfilment centres, cross-border gateways and urban delivery fleets. Singapore's online retail share remained structurally above pre-pandemic levels, while the country's population reached **6.11 million in 2025**. High order frequency and a compact address base create attractive route density, but delivery speed, failed-delivery prevention and returns handling remain commercially decisive.

Jurong, Changi and the eastern logistics corridor form the principal supply cluster because they combine airport cargo, port connectivity, free-trade zones and major distribution facilities. Changi Airport handled **2.08 million tonnes of airfreight in 2025**, while Singapore's port processed **44.66 million TEUs in 2025**. This infrastructure enables domestic fulfilment, regional inventory pooling and international parcel transshipment.

Market access is shaped by postal licensing, customs declarations, consumer protection, data governance and tax rules. Since January 2023, GST has applied to imported low-value goods of **S$400 or less** purchased from registered overseas vendors. The rule increases checkout transparency and compliance requirements for marketplaces, carriers and customs intermediaries while reducing the previous tax advantage available to selected cross-border sellers.

Singapore is transitioning from labour-intensive parcel handling toward automated sorting, predictive routing, parcel lockers and data-integrated fulfilment. The digital economy represented **18.6% of GDP in 2024**, while 95.1% of SMEs adopted at least one digital area. Investors should view logistics software, automated fulfilment and cross-border compliance capabilities as profit-pool enablers rather than administrative support functions.

## Future Outlook

The Singapore E-Commerce Logistics Market is projected to expand from USD 1,420 million in 2025 to USD 2,260 million by 2031, representing an 8.1% forecast CAGR. Growth moderates from the 9.7% historical CAGR recorded during 2020-2025 as pandemic-led channel migration normalises. Shipment density, social commerce, regional seller participation and higher service expectations nevertheless continue to expand logistics revenue. Parcel volume is projected to rise from 286 million shipments in 2025 to 446 million in 2031, while automation and route consolidation limit excessive unit-cost inflation.

Profit pools are expected to shift toward integrated fulfilment, cross-border customs management, premium delivery windows, returns orchestration and technology-enabled merchant services. Cross-border shipments are projected to increase from 55.0% of market-linked parcel volume in 2025 to 58.0% by 2031, raising demand for bonded handling and data accuracy. Average revenue per shipment remains near USD 5.00 because basic delivery pricing faces competition, but service mix improves. Operators with automated hubs, platform integrations, locker networks and disciplined subcontractor management should outperform asset-light carriers dependent on price-led tendering.

### Historical Market Performance (2020-2025)

Revenue growth peaked at 12.6% in 2021 as pandemic conditions compressed several years of digital channel adoption into a short period. The pace eased to 7.2% in 2025 as delivery networks normalised and aggressive carrier pricing limited revenue expansion despite shipment growth. Parcel volume rose by an estimated 64.4% between 2020 and 2025. The main inflection occurred during 2022-2023, when operators moved from emergency capacity additions toward automated hubs, contracted-driver optimisation and merchant integration.

### Forecast Market Outlook (2026-2031)

Forecast growth is expected to stabilise near 8% annually before reaching 8.4% in 2031, driven by cross-border parcel mix, premium service tiers and fulfilment outsourcing. Market value reaches USD 2,260 million in 2031, while parcel volume expands to 446 million shipments. The slight acceleration at the end of the period reflects higher monetisation from managed returns, customs compliance and inventory services. Margin expansion depends on automation, route density and reduced failed-delivery costs rather than broad-based price increases.

### Key Segmentation Takeaways

Comprehensive analysis across all extracted segmentation dimensions providing insights into market structure, customer requirements, service economics and fulfilment patterns.

**Service Type** - Last-mile delivery remains the largest revenue pool because every domestic and inbound e-commerce order requires final address delivery or collection-point handoff. Fulfilment and returns services are smaller but deliver stronger customer retention and higher revenue per merchant. Large carriers increasingly bundle storage, pick-pack, customs and delivery to reduce merchant switching and improve asset utilisation.

**Technology** - Technology is the fastest-growing segmentation dimension because labour availability, delivery-window compression and peak volatility make manual scaling uneconomic. Automated sortation, route optimisation, merchant APIs and locker networks improve throughput and first-attempt delivery performance. The fastest-growing sub-segment is route and capacity optimisation, which directly reduces kilometres travelled, driver idle time and failed-delivery exposure.

## Growth Drivers

### Growth Drivers, Challenges & Opportunities

Comprehensive analysis of key factors shaping the Singapore E-Commerce Logistics Market, including growth catalysts, operational challenges, and emerging opportunities across fulfilment, distribution and consumer delivery segments.

## Growth Drivers

### High Digital Commerce Intensity

Online retail represented **15.1% (May 2026, Singapore)** of retail sales, sustaining structurally high parcel demand. 

* Singapore's e-commerce GMV reached approximately **USD 9 billion (2025, Singapore)**, giving carriers a substantial addressable flow across marketplace, brand-direct and social-commerce channels. 
* Resident household internet access was **99% (2024, Singapore)**, reducing digital-access constraints and supporting repeat purchasing across income and age cohorts. 
* The digital economy represented **18.6% of GDP (2024, Singapore)**, supporting platform investment and merchant digitisation that translate directly into fulfilment and delivery demand. 

### Cross-Border Trade and Gateway Infrastructure

Cross-border orders represented an estimated **55% (2025, Singapore)** of online transaction value, expanding customs and line-haul revenue pools. 

* Changi handled **2.08 million tonnes (2025, Singapore)** of airfreight, providing high-frequency capacity for time-sensitive inbound parcels and regional redistribution. 
* Port throughput reached **44.66 million TEUs (2025, Singapore)**, strengthening ocean consolidation economics for bulky and lower-value e-commerce imports. 
* Approximately **90% (2024, Singapore)** of container throughput was transshipment, enabling operators to combine domestic parcel demand with regional hub operations. 

### Merchant Outsourcing and Service Bundling

SME digital adoption reached **95.1% (2024, Singapore)**, broadening demand for outsourced fulfilment and API-enabled shipping. 

* SMEs adopted an average of **2.3 digital areas (2024, Singapore)**, increasing readiness for integrated order, inventory and delivery workflows. 
* More than **7,200 businesses (2025, Singapore)** adopted AI-enabled, integrated or cloud solutions through supported programmes, improving merchant capability to use sophisticated logistics services. 
* Over **200 pre-approved solutions (2025, Singapore)** were available for SME digitalisation support, reducing implementation barriers for fulfilment and commerce integration. 

---

## Market Challenges

### Labour and Last-Mile Cost Pressure

Average revenue remained near **USD 4.97 per shipment (2025, Singapore)**, limiting room to absorb labour and peak-capacity inflation.

* A compact but high-service market requires delivery windows across **286 million shipments (2025, Singapore)**, making driver productivity and route density central to margins.
* Failed deliveries create a second handling cycle in a market where parcel volume is projected to reach **446 million shipments (2031, Singapore)**, increasing the value of lockers and scheduled handoffs.
* Price-led marketplace tenders compress delivery margins, so operators must shift revenue toward fulfilment, returns and cross-border services representing an estimated **44% of revenue (2031, Singapore)**.

### Customs, Tax and Data Compliance Complexity

GST applies to imported low-value goods of **S$400 or less (since 2023, Singapore)**, increasing seller and carrier data obligations. 

* Importers must comply with the Customs Act, GST Act and Regulation of Imports and Exports Act, while inaccurate declarations can trigger fines up to **S$10,000 (2026, Singapore)**. 
* Permit waivers apply only to qualifying non-controlled, non-dutiable air imports with CIF value of **S$400 or less (2026, Singapore)**, creating process differences by transport mode. 
* Cross-border orders account for an estimated **55% of online transaction value (2025, Singapore)**, magnifying the operational impact of classification, valuation and tax errors. 

### Intense Competition and Platform Captivity

The top ten operators control an estimated **90.5% (2025, Singapore)** of market revenue, intensifying scale and integration requirements.

* Platform-captive networks account for an estimated **24% of market revenue (2025, Singapore)**, reducing contestable volume for independent carriers.
* Basic last-mile delivery represents approximately **46% of market revenue (2025, Singapore)**, exposing operators to the most price-sensitive service category.
* Singapore Post's share price had fallen about **65% from 2018 to 2024**, illustrating how service failures and structural competition can erode investor confidence. 

---

## Market Opportunities

### Regional Fulfilment and Customs Control Towers

Cross-border flows reach an estimated **58% of shipments by 2031**, creating monetisable demand for compliance-led orchestration.

* Operators can bundle bonded receiving, customs data, multi-country allocation and returns into contracts priced above basic delivery, targeting a projected **USD 2.26 billion market (2031, Singapore)**.
* Marketplaces, regional brands and D2C merchants benefit from a single inventory pool connected to **44.66 million TEUs (2025, Singapore)** of port throughput. 
* Opportunity realisation requires unified tariff classification, landed-cost calculation and customer-level visibility across a market where low-value goods rules cover items up to **S$400 (2023, Singapore)**. 

### Automated Micro-Fulfilment and Parcel Lockers

Parcel volume is forecast to rise to **446 million shipments (2031, Singapore)**, supporting automation and alternative handoff economics.

* Investors can target shared micro-fulfilment and locker networks that earn storage, handling and access fees while reducing repeat delivery costs across dense residential districts.
* Carriers, retailers and property owners benefit because locker handoffs consolidate home stops, improving vehicle utilisation as volume grows at a projected **7.7% CAGR (2025-2031, Singapore)**.
* Realisation requires interoperable carrier access, secure identity verification and building-owner agreements, supported by resident household internet access of **99% (2024, Singapore)**. 

### Returns, Refurbishment and Circular Commerce

Returns and value-added services are projected to exceed **USD 250 million (2031, Singapore)**, creating higher-margin service pools.

* Operators can charge for pickup, grading, refurbishment, repackaging and resale routing, monetising activities outside commodity delivery tariffs.
* Fashion, electronics and resale platforms benefit because these categories generate frequent exchanges and require condition assessment before inventory can be returned to sale.
* Opportunity capture requires integrated return authorisation, item-level tracking and refurbishment partnerships across an e-commerce market near **USD 9 billion GMV (2025, Singapore)**.

## Competitive Landscape

# CHAPTER 8 - Competitive Landscape Overview

Competition is concentrated among platform-linked carriers, regional parcel specialists, the postal incumbent and global integrators. Entry barriers arise from sorting capacity, merchant APIs, customs capability, service reliability and the route density required to sustain low unit costs.

* **Key players:** 10
* **New Entrants (last 5 yrs):** 3

### Company Profiles (Top 10 Players)

| Company Name | Market Share | Headquarters | Founding Year | Core Market Focus |
| --- | --- | --- | --- | --- |
| Ninja Van | 18.5% (estimated) | Singapore | 2014 | Domestic and regional e-commerce parcel delivery |
| SPX Express | 17.0% (estimated) | Singapore | - | Platform-captive fulfilment and last-mile delivery |
| J&T Express | 13.5% (estimated) | Jakarta, Indonesia | 2015 | High-volume e-commerce express and cross-border parcels |
| Singapore Post and Speedpost | 12.0% (estimated) | Singapore | 1819 | Postal parcels, domestic delivery and cross-border e-commerce |
| DHL eCommerce | 8.5% (estimated) | Bonn, Germany | 1969 | International e-commerce parcels and fulfilment |
| FedEx | 6.0% (estimated) | Memphis, United States | 1971 | International express and premium cross-border delivery |
| UPS | 5.0% (estimated) | Atlanta, United States | 1907 | International express, brokerage and enterprise shipping |
| SF Express | 4.5% (estimated) | Shenzhen, China | 1993 | China-Singapore cross-border express and supply chain services |
| iMile | 3.0% (estimated) | Dubai, United Arab Emirates | 2017 | Cross-border e-commerce and technology-led last mile |
| Janio Asia | 2.5% (estimated) | Singapore | 2018 | ASEAN cross-border logistics orchestration |

#### Q: What was the size of the Singapore E-Commerce Logistics Market in 2025?

**A:** The Singapore E-Commerce Logistics Market was worth USD 1,420 million in 2025. The estimate covers domestic e-commerce delivery, cross-border parcel handling, fulfilment, returns and directly related value-added logistics services. It excludes merchandise value, general freight unrelated to e-commerce and internal logistics costs that do not represent third-party revenue. The market was triangulated through company-revenue estimates, parcel volumes and demand-side logistics intensity, with a confidence range of USD 1,280-1,560 million.
